Predicting and Filtering Sensory Information
This chapter discusses how our brain predicts and filters sensory information based on expectations, focusing on unexpected stimuli and building an internal model of the world. It explores the role of attention in updating the internal model and the phenomenon of blocking. The chapter also explains how an internal model is applicable to machines and discusses the connection between brain adaptation to drugs and withdrawal symptoms.
